TIMEOUT provides the routing for rotary dial callers.
Note
IfActionisset0or6skipDatasetting.
"XXX"= change as it fit
The “Data” data needs to follow these rules below.
0 (UND) = none
1 (TRF) = dial data (any), X, I, N, or P
2 (UTRF) = dial data (any), X, I, N, or P
3 (REC1) = mailbox number (subscriber or group)
4 (REC2) = mailbox number (subscriber or group)
5 (LOGON) = mailbox number (subscriber or group)
6 (HANGUP) = none
7 (GOTO) = routing mailbox number index (1 ~ 32)
Otherwise it will not be routed properly.
